This intensive training has two components;
The first component of the training is to provide practical tools and skills for anyone working with clients in an individual setting. These tools and skills will assist them to be grounded, present and mindful when working with their clients. At the same time they will also be able to use these tools to guide their clients through a process of a direct somatic experience to ensure a more focused and solution orientated session. Being present and mindful will deepen and enhance the relationship between the facilitator of the session and their clients.
The second component is to learn and experience the powerful method of Family & Systemic Constellations Work (FSC). Every participant will have the opportunity to embark on their own development work and exploration of personal blind spots. In this somatically based, phenomenological process each participant will experience a new way of being present or holding mindful attention of body sensations and emotions. The body is used as a tool in this almost non-verbal way of working to discover, unfold and resolve hidden dynamics and entanglements which belong to the participant’s family or any other system. The process allows an actual experiencing of what a human system is and of the inter-connectedness of each member of the system. The consequences of imbalances or exclusions in a system and the impact this has on the system and the client, will be understood not only in terms of theory, but will be physically experienced. The skill of working with the method of FSC will be learnt through experiential processes and theory.

Who is it for?
This course is for anybody whose work brings them into contact with family and other social systems, for example:
- Therapists, counsellors, health professionals and those in related fields
- Social care professionals working with children and families, marginalized social groups and refugees.
- Those working in the field of substance abuse and in the criminal justice system.
As it is a method for dealing with human systems that can help to find a place for every member of the system, this approach integrates with and deepens other resolution-oriented perspectives. At this foundation level the training is offered as an enrichment of existing practice and not as a qualification. This course rather offers an excellent grounding in the theory and practice of this work from two of South Africa’s leading facilitators.
